How much does it cost to rent a home in Cascade?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Cascade 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,163 | $770 | $1,700 |
| Cascade 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,366 | $875 | $1,810 |
| Cascade 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,373 | $1,720 | $2,900 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cascade
What type of rentals are currently available in Cascade?
There are currently 64 Apartments for Rent in Cascade, IA with pricing that ranges from $460 to $2,950. There are also 32 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Cascade ranging from $350 to $2,900.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Cascade?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Cascade ranges from $350 to $2,900 with an average monthly rent of $1,372.
